Atlantic Puffin vs Guiana Dolphin

Fratercula arctica compared with Sotalia guianensis

Key Differences

  • Atlantic Puffin is Vulnerable while Guiana Dolphin is Data Deficient.

Taxonomic Classification

Rank Atlantic Puffin Guiana Dolphin
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um same Chordata (Chordates)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Aves (Birds)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Charadriiformes (Charadriiformes) Cetacea (Whales & Dolphins)
Family Alcidae Delphinidae (Oceanic Dolphins)
Genus Fratercula Sotalia
Species Fratercula arctica Sotalia guianensis

Evolutionary Relationship

Atlantic Puffin and Guiana Dolphin share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
